For this weeks' inspiration post I chose the Ching-Chou Kuik Digital Stamp called "Toadstool Fairy" to work with. I wanted to make an extra special birthday card that had a bit of WOW!! I have coloured the image in with my Promarkers and then used a blue, green, pink and yellow Pan Pastel and blended it all in with the Pan Pastel blender.
The shape of the card came from Kathryn Sturrock who I saw making a card like this on Create and Craft a few weeks ago. She used two A5 pieces of card, added some score lines and hey presto a dimensional card - but one that can be folded flat to go in an envelope but springs to life as soon as it is released out of the envelope - the only problem with it is that it's not that easy to photograph especially when using mirri card!!!
The backing papers I have used are from Joy! Crafts and are there "Under the Sea" paper pad. It is such good quality paper. The flowers took the time to punch out and ink and they were made with the same backing papers.
I have finished the card off with the punched flowers, Craftwork Cards die-cut sentiment, liquid pearls for the spots on the toadstools, die-cut butterflies (inked and Stickles glitter glue added), Papermania Glitterations, ribbon bow and a pearl.
